Pentax K-m has a
10.0MP APS-C (23.5 x 15.7 mm ) sized CCD sensor . On the other hand, Pentax K110D has a
6.0MP APS-C (23.5 x 15.7 mm ) sized CCD sensor .
Below you can see the K-m and K110D sensor size comparison.
Sensor Size and Resolution Comparison image of Pentax K-m and Pentax K110D Cameras
Pentax K-m and Pentax K110D have the same sensor sizes so they will provide same level of control over the depth of field when used with same focal length and aperture. On the other hand, since Pentax K110D has 66% larger pixel area (61.08µm 2 vs 36.75µm 2 ) compared to Pentax K-m, it has larger pixel area to collect light hence potential to have less noise in low light / High ISO images.
